Religious practice on the world wide web: an original experience of the norm

Abstract

International audience In continuation of studies on the practices of the sacred in the World Wide Web, we propose in this paper a hypothesis that seems not only relevant but also essential to approach this problem, whatever the theme or the angle considered. The hypothesis is the following: any sacred practice in the World Wide Web is an expression of innovative experience of a norm. More precisely, we postulate that in any study on the sacred in relation to the World Wide Web necessarily four items must be considered: the transgressions of technology norms and reports to the representations, the theoretical apparatus of orientation in the production process meaning, the functional normative of dialectic ritual, the constant innovation of the norm.
